XI. Disclosure Review; Confidentiality of Information.
Participating Adviser agrees that it shall have reasonable grounds to believe based on the information made available to it through the Memoranda or other information reasonably requested by Participating Adviser and made available to Participating Adviser by the Dealer Manager or the Company that all material facts are adequately and accurately disclosed in the Memoranda and that the Memoranda provides a reasonable basis for evaluating an investment in the DST Interests. In making this determination, Participating Adviser shall evaluate, at a minimum, items of compensation, physical properties, tax aspects, financial stability and experience of Company, conflicts of interest and risk factors, and appraisals and other pertinent reports.
If Participating Adviser relies upon the results of any inquiry conducted by a member or members of FINRA, Participating Adviser shall have reasonable grounds to believe that such inquiry was conducted with due care, that the member or members conducting or directing the inquiry consented to the disclosure of the results of the inquiry and that the person who participated in or conducted the inquiry is not the Dealer Manager or a sponsor or an affiliate of the Company.
It is anticipated that (a) Participating Adviser and Participating Adviser’s officers, directors, managers, employees, owners, members, partners, diligence personnel or other agents of Participating Adviser that are conducting a due diligence inquiry on behalf of Participating Adviser and (b) persons or committees, as the case may be, responsible for determining whether Participating Adviser will participate in the Offering ((a) and (b) are collectively, the “Diligence Representatives”) either have previously or will in the future have access to certain Confidential Information (defined below) pertaining to the Company, the Operating Partnership, the Trusts, the Dealer Manager, the Adviser, or their respective affiliates. For purposes hereof, “Confidential Information” shall mean and include: (i) trade secrets concerning the business and affairs of the Company, the Operating Partnership, the Trusts, the Dealer Manager, the Adviser, or their respective affiliates; (ii) confidential data, know-how, current and planned research and development, current and planned methods and processes, marketing lists or strategies, slide presentations, business plans, however documented, belonging to the Company, the Operating Partnership, the Trusts, the Dealer Manager, the Adviser, or their respective affiliates; (iii) information concerning the business and affairs of the Company, the Operating Partnership, the Trusts, the Dealer Manager, the Adviser, or their respective affiliates (including, without limitation, historical financial statements, financial projections and budgets, investment-related information, models, budgets, plans, and market studies, however documented); (iv) any information marked or designated “Confidential—For Due Diligence Purposes Only”; and (v) any notes, analysis, compilations, studies, summaries and other material containing or based, in whole or in part, on any information included in the foregoing. Participating Adviser agrees to keep, and to cause its Diligence Representatives to keep, all such Confidential Information strictly confidential and to not use, distribute or copy the same except in connection with Participating Adviser’s due diligence inquiry. Participating Adviser agrees to not disclose, and to cause its Diligence Representatives not to disclose, such Confidential Information to the public, or to Participating Adviser’s sales staff, financial advisors, or any person involved in selling efforts related to the Offering or to any other third party and agrees not to use the Confidential Information in any manner in the offer and sale of the DST Interests.
Participating Adviser further agrees to use all reasonable precautions necessary to preserve the confidentiality of such Confidential Information, including, but not limited to (a) limiting access to such information to persons who have a need to know such information only for the purpose of Participating Adviser’s due diligence inquiry and (b) informing each recipient of such Confidential Information of Participating Adviser’s confidentiality obligation.
